| Merry Xmas--Freebies Here Hi Friends: This topic has been done everywhere, probably including here. But, why not see what freebies people are finding to be useful now. I try to avoid installing software, including free software when I can, and, its hard not to do so. There are many appealing bits of freeware out there. So, I don't use many freebies. Here are the ones I currently am using--other than the standard freebies: 1. CCCleaner--for registry cleaning primarily (but, I donated $20) 2. Paint.NET--a substitute for Photoshop given my lightweight photo-editing needs from my laptop. (Photoshop on desktop) 3. ieSpell--very good spell checker for IE 4. Comodo Firewall--64-bit desktop 5. ZoneAlarm Firewall--32-bit machines (Comodo is available, of course, for 32-bit Vista too, is as good as ZoneAlarm (no 64-bit support), and is more user friendly than ZoneAlarm). 6. Skype

| The freebies I am using right now are: Paint.net, the Gimp, Avast Home, on this computer and AVG free on my 2 XP computers, AbiWord, Open Office.Org(on my XP SP1 machine),ArtRage (an excellent painting program for freehand art), and BelArc Advisor. I use Paint.Net for resizing my photos for avatars and other Web pictures. |

| freebies i have right now, well the ones i can remember of the top of my head: Foxit Reader Lightweight PDF reader Vista Shortcut Overlay Remover Removes Shortcut arrows in Vista Klite Codec Pack Hundreds of audio and video codecs in one installer Visual Studio 2008 Express Edition Free Web editor and dev programs for windows, xbox 360 and web platforms. Windows Live Messenger Obviously a messenger client for the Windows live and Yahoo! based community. Windows Live Writer Post to your blog with a full online WYSIWYG interface.
